

随着信息化建设的不断推进,惠州地区的网络基础设施也得到了显著提升。为了更好地评估和优化网络性能,本文将介绍如何利用JMeter进行性能测试,并探讨其在网络架构中的应用。JMeter是一款开源的负载测试工具,广泛应用于Web应用性能测试、接口测试等领域。
惠州的综合布线系统通常包括数据中心、核心交换机、汇聚层交换机、接入层交换机等多个层次。数据中心作为信息处理的核心,需要具备高可用性和高性能。因此,在设计网络架构时,需要充分考虑带宽、延迟、容错机制等因素。
JMeter能够模拟大量用户并发访问服务器的情况,从而检测服务器的响应时间、吞吐量等性能指标。通过JMeter,我们可以有效地评估网络架构的性能,发现潜在的问题并进行优化。
首先,我们需要创建一个测试计划,定义要测试的目标。例如,如果要测试数据中心的Web服务性能,可以设置HTTP请求来模拟用户的访问行为。
线程组用于模拟虚拟用户。通过调整线程数、循环次数等参数,可以控制测试的并发度。例如,设置100个线程组,每个线程循环执行10次,可以模拟1000个用户的并发访问。
在JMeter中添加HTTP请求,配置目标URL、方法(GET/POST)、请求参数等信息。对于复杂的场景,还可以配置头部信息、Cookie管理器等,以更真实地模拟用户行为。
监听器用于收集和展示测试结果。常用的监听器包括聚合报告、视图结果树等。聚合报告提供详细的性能统计数据,如平均响应时间、吞吐量等;视图结果树则展示每个请求的具体响应情况。
完成上述配置后,可以启动测试。JMeter会按照设定的参数模拟用户并发访问,并记录下所有的响应数据。
测试完成后,通过查看监听器提供的数据,分析服务器的性能表现。重点关注响应时间、吞吐量、错误率等关键指标。如果发现问题,可以通过调整网络配置、优化代码等方式进行改进。
假设惠州某数据中心需要进行性能测试,以验证其Web服务能否应对大量并发访问。通过JMeter模拟了1000个用户的并发访问,并设置了不同的测试场景:
测试结果显示,在基础场景下,服务器响应时间在合理范围内,但在高并发场景下,响应时间明显增加,甚至出现了部分请求超时的情况。通过进一步分析,发现主要是由于数据库查询效率低下导致。为此,技术团队对数据库进行了优化,并调整了部分查询逻辑,最终使得高并发场景下的性能有了显著提升。
通过JMeter进行性能测试,可以帮助我们全面了解惠州综合布线系统的网络架构性能。结合实际测试结果,可以有针对性地优化网络配置和应用程序,从而提高整体系统的稳定性和响应速度。希望本文能为相关领域的技术人员提供一定的参考和借鉴价值。
Copyright © 2002-2024